Download Sample Ask For Discount Japan Concrete Floor Saw Blades Market By Type Segment Analysis The Japan concrete floor saw blades market is primarily segmented based on blade type, encompassing diamond blades, abrasive blades, and hybrid variants. Diamond blades dominate the market due to their superior cutting performance, durability, and ability to handle tough concrete compositions. These blades are classified further into continuous rim, segmented rim, turbo rim, and turbo segmented rim, each tailored for specific applications such as dry cutting, wet cutting, or high-speed operations. Abrasive blades, though historically prevalent, are witnessing a decline in market share owing to their comparatively limited lifespan and lower efficiency, especially in demanding construction environments. Hybrid blades, integrating features of both diamond and abrasive technologies, are emerging as niche segments catering to specialized applications requiring versatility and precision. Market size estimates suggest that diamond blades account for approximately 70-75% of the total market value, with an annual growth rate (CAGR) of around 4-5% projected over the next five years. The abrasive segment holds roughly 20-25%, experiencing a slower CAGR of about 2-3%, primarily driven by retrofit and maintenance sectors. The fastest-growing segment is the turbo rim diamond blades, which are gaining traction due to their enhanced cutting speed and reduced vibration, especially in large-scale commercial projects.
